u/jacquesfuriously Jun 10 '23
The American version of Power Rangers actually included footage from the original Japanese series .... like most of the Megazord/giant monster battle scenes or pretty much most of the cool fight scenes.
It was pretty easy to tell since you see a sudden change in the fidelity and quality of the picture.

u/Aminusasian Jun 10 '23
Power Rangers is just recasted and translated version of Japan’s Super Sentai. Sometimes some graphics such as transformation sequences are changed too but Super Sentai is the original.
→ More replies (1)34
u/trustfulcamel Jun 10 '23
It's not even translated, they made up their own plot and just use Super Sentai footage for fights. Real shame, Super Sentai has actually decent plot most of the time (or at least that was the case for the seasons that i watched).

u/PhoenixFox Jun 10 '23 edited Jun 10 '23
Depends on your definition of 'original', given there are different actors for in and out of suit. Crossovers like these pretty rarely have the out-of-suit actors for older characters come back, when they do it's usually a pretty big deal. It's a lot easier to get the suit out of storage and use recycled voice lines.
When it comes to suit actors, almost none of them will be 'correct', particularly on the Kamen Rider side. It's very common for the same suit actors to be in multiple seasons in a row, playing various characters, to the extent that the main riders for 19 seasons in a row (with one exception) had the same suit actor. I can see three characters played by him in the first frame alone - obviously for crossovers they get different suit actors to play the returning characters in group shots. Mirroring the mannerisms and body language of a character that's also been played by someone else is a huge part of the art of suit acting, since even for the current season they have to believably match the personality of the 'real' actor.
Super Sentai will also heavily feature the a regular cast of suit actors but I don't know enough about it in the same level of detail to comment on how often the main rangers are the same set.
